锅炉加热配料过程控制系统

模型HV-EXP4471

技术描述:

这个完整和全面装备的实验室试验台提供了从过程控制领域的许多可能的实验。它包含四个不同的控制回路与本地数字,工业控制器。此外,它还可以实现两个级联控制系统。为级联控制提供了进一步的控制器。控制器可以根据需要相互独立配置,可以单独或同时操作。它们都有串行接口。实验部分由一个封闭的水回路构成。水由1.1 kW离心泵通过管道系统从供水罐中泵出。该电路中包括一个气动驱动控制阀,可以改变流量,从而控制电路。液位可以在两个不同容量的不锈钢罐中控制。 For this purpose a bypass mounted on the tank feed is controlled by a further pneumatic valve. The two tanks can be connected together to change the characteristic of the control loop. An electronically adjustable 7.5 kW heater enables to heat the water as part of a temperature control system. During overheating, a siren and an alarm lamp will be activated. The system water in the circuit can be cooled by a heat exchanger. Fresh water from an external water supply is used as cooling liquid. The pressure control system uses external compressed air at one of the two tanks. The test stand is built using only industrial standard components to increase its relevance to practice. The support made of steel tubes is fitted with laboratory castors and can thus be easily moved around. Software for the process visualisation and Profibus card are available as an accessory.
